Seven People Hospitalized & Over 80 Injured In Hailstorm At Red Rocks Show

Seven people were hospitalized and over 80 people were injured during a concert last night at the popular Colorado venue Red Rocks Amphitheatre.

A huge storm including lightning and “apple-sized” hail caused multiple injuries at Red Rocks during a Louis Tomlinson concert with seven people taken to the hospital and a range of 80 to 90 people treated at the scene with cuts and broken bones.

The event was reportedly delayed, with the venue advising attendees to seek shelter in their cars as the hail and rain raged.

They eventually gave the all clear and concertgoers began to head back into the show, only for an announcement an hour later for fans to head back to their cars as more severe weather was approaching.

Videos showed people getting pelted by gigantic balls of hail, rain flooding down staircases in a dangerous rush, and lightning flashing in the background.

One attendee told The Denver Gazette the impact from the hail broke their partner’s windshield.

The concert was then cancelled.

Red Rocks has addressed the incident on their social media, stating, “We want to take a moment to acknowledge the severe weather event at Red Rocks last night and offer our sincere best wishes to everyone affected by last night’s storms across Colorado.”

They continued, “And, we’re having a little talk with Mother Nature about this weather business at Red Rocks. Between a wind-whipped opening night wildfire, snow showers, torrential rains and hail, it’s been a crazy six weeks in the foothills” before going on to promote their upcoming shows.

Fans have been very vocal in the comments on both sides of the argument with some claiming vendors were mocking attendees as they tried to hide under the concession stands and others are claiming that the weather forecast was clearly extreme and people should have stayed home.

But the venue is offering refunds for the Louis Tomlinson show with more information to come to ticketholders.
